Synonyma

Synonyms

— která; strī — žena; aṅga — ó Kṛṣṇo; te — Tvými; kala-pada — rytmy; amṛta-veṇu-gīta — sladkých písní flétny; sammohitā — uchvácena; ārya-caritāt — z cesty cudnosti podle měřítek védské civilizace; na — ne; calet — sešla by; tri-lokyām — ve třech světech; trai-lokya-saubhagam — která je štěstím tří světů; idam — této; ca — a; nirīkṣya — pozorováním; rūpam — krásy; yat — které; go — krávy; dvija — ptáci; druma — stromy; mṛgāḥ — lesní zvířata jako jeleni; pulakāni — transcendentální blaženost; abibhran — projevili.

— what; strī — woman; aṅga — O Kṛṣṇa; te — of You; kala-pada — by the rhythms; amṛta-veṇu-gīta — of the sweet songs of the flute; sammohitā — being captivated; ārya-caritāt — from the path of chastity according to Vedic civilization; na — not; calet — would wander; tri-lokyām — in the three worlds; trai-lokya-saubhagam — which is the fortune of the three worlds; idam — this; ca — and; nirīkṣya — by observing; rūpam — beauty; yat — which; go — the cows; dvija — birds; druma — trees; mṛgāḥ — forest animals like the deer; pulakāni — transcendental jubilation; abibhran — manifested.

Překlad

Translation

„(Gopī řekly:) ,Můj drahý Pane Kṛṣṇo, kde je ve třech světech žena, která by nebyla uchvácena rytmy sladkých písní vycházejících ze Tvé úžasné flétny? Kterou by to nesvedlo z cesty cudnosti? Tvoje krása je to nejvznešenější ve třech světech. Dokonce i krávy, ptáci, zvířata a stromy v lese ztuhnou blažeností, když zahlédnou Tvou krásu.̀  “

“[The gopīs said:] ‘My dear Lord Kṛṣṇa, where is that woman within the three worlds who would not be captivated by the rhythms of the sweet songs coming from Your wonderful flute? Who would not fall down from the path of chastity in this way? Your beauty is the most sublime within the three worlds. Upon seeing Your beauty, even cows, birds, animals and trees in the forest are stunned in jubilation.”’

Význam

Purport

Tento verš je citátem ze Śrīmad-Bhāgavatamu (10.29.40).

This verse is from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am (10.29.40).
